IN REMEMBRANCE OF FELA ANIKULAPO KUTI:THE MOST INCREDIBLE MUSICIAN OF OUR TIME!

Story by Niyi Tabiti
Photo courtesy:Fela photo Library


Dead or alive, Fela Anikulapo Kuti remains the most enigmatic music phenomenon ever to come out of Nigeria. That is why his post humous birthday celebration has continued to attract thousands of people from all walks of life. This year’s edition is no exception as thousands of ardent music lovers who believe so much in ‘Fela-sophy’, music researchers and fans troop en masse to the new Afrikka Shrine (owned by his son, Femi Kuti) to pay ‘Baba 70’ homage even in death.Starting started on Tuesday 14 and ended on Sunday 19 October 2008.
Of course, it brought alive, the memories of the late ‘Abami Eda’ (The strange man) who lived and sang against corrupt practices in government. He was harassed by security agents, arrested and jailed at different times.So incredible was Fela that he would be remembered as the first Nigerian artiste who composed songs and openely berated military governments in power.Unknown Soldier, one of his popular songs was done after soldiers caused damages that led to his mother’s death durning the military regime of General Olusegun Obasanjo in the 70s.
Beyond Fela’s human rights activism, He was also known to have engaged in open display of ‘Indian hemp’ smoking.Perhaps, the reason why the Afrikka Shrine also went up in flames (lol) as young and old, rich and poor came to smoke that ‘thing’ that make them ‘high!’
He believed so much in African culture and tradition- the reason he changed his name his surname from Ransome-Kuti to 'Anikulapo' Kuti ( the one who has death in his pocket).He prroclaim the african worship of ifa divination and other gods as his own way of life.Known to have married 27 wives the same day before he divorced them in 1986, Fela died in 1997 due to what the family described as illness resulting from infection of the HIV/AIDS.
Today, Yeni, Femi and Seun the children he left behind seems to have taken his foot steps.Apparently, they are aware of the fact that they could only try but not wear the big shoe left behind by their father and mentor.

9ICE BEATS D'BANJ,PSQUARE,FAZE...DECLARED MOBO BEST AFRICAN ACT LAST NIGHT IN LONDON


By Niyi Tabiti
Chief Reporter
History was re-written last night (15 October 2008) in London as Nigerian born rave of the moment musician; 9ice grabbed the MOBO 2008 award as the Best African act. He was confirmed the winner of the award after a fierce contest with fellow compatriots like D’Banj, Faze, Asa and Psquare.9ice became the second Nigerian to have won the award so far.
Other gifted musicians who also competed with him from other parts of Africa included Jua Cali, Magic System,HHP,Wahu and Jozi
In a statement issued by his publicist, Mr.Ayeni Adekunle, he stated that what seems to be like an ordinary lyrics has turned out to be prophetic. The elated publicist who seems to be bubbling like a man whose team has just won a premiership, reminded us how the artiste stated that “don’t doubt me, I will bring home Grammy”, in his song ‘Street Credibility’
9ice has climb the ladder of professional music success in such a way that shows the grammy award he sang about would soon become a reality.
Dehinde Fajana, manager of 9ice said today "The award is coming to Nigeria. It doesn't matter who won. It's an award for all the Nigerian nominees"
Information reaching gistmaster indicates that 9ice is expected back to Nigeria on Friday.He is expected to meet a team of journalists and visit to some selected media houses before jetting out on October 21 for a performance tour of the United States of America.9ice first international exposure was June 2008 when he performed at the fabulous 90th birthday of former South African President,Dr.Nelson Mandela in UK.

LILIAN UGBOEKE, PRETTY MOTHER OF SIX SET FOR MOST GORGEOUS MOM BEAUTY PAGEANT

Story & photos by Niyi Tabiti
Chief Reporter

Lilian Ugboeke, a model and groomer is set to host the first ever most gorgeous mom beauty pageant in December 2008 at Lagoon Restaurant,Victoria Island, Lagos, Nigeria. Unbelievably, Lilian is a beautiful mother of six children! (Three boys and three girls)
I remember, the first time I was introduced to Lilian about six or seven years ago by Ronke Apampa,a top presenter and model who resides in London.I was shocked when I learnt she already had 5 children.She still has a lovely figure that could make anyone want to believe she is still single.After doing her first interview that year,i got loads of emails from guys who wanted to date her.
Coincidentally, we were both on Solid entertainment,a morning programme hosted by Patience on Galaxy Television this morning.After mine,she was the next person to come air.
She was very excited about her new project.Lilian disclosed that sponsors are already falling over themselves because of the excellent drive that is being injected into the pageant.She also said planning the event took her three years and now is the time to let it out. The Director of Sleek Production told www.niyitabiti.blogspot.com that the winner would go home with N5 Million Naira, a brand new car and other fringe benefits.
Right now, interested women are already collecting their forms so that they could participate.On the 29th of November, there would be a grand reception for all the contestants.On that same day, they would accomodated for one week to enable them prepare for the contest.She disclosed bikini or any form of indecency would not be encouraged.
